The Hilltop Drive-In was operated by Delft Theatres when it opened and later by Mescop and then M. Peterson. The drive-in opened on May 1, 1953 with Charlton Heston in “The Savage”. It had a car capacity listed at 500 with a single screen. It is listed as closing in 1989 and has since been demolished.
